SPECIFICATIONS

Parameters
Supply Voltage-Min (Vsup) 2.375V
Number of Circuits 1
Frequency (Max) 2GHz
Input LVDS
Logic IC Type LOW SKEW CLOCK DRIVER
Prop. Delay@Nom-Sup 0.525 ns
Propagation Delay (tpd) 0.475 ns
Same Edge Skew-Max (tskwd) 0.045 ns
Number of True Outputs 5
Length 6.5mm
Width 4.4mm
Radiation Hardening No
RoHS Status RoHS Compliant
Mount Surface Mount
Package / Case TSSOP
Number of Pins 20
Packaging Tape & Reel (TR)
Published 2003
JESD-609 Code e0
Pbfree Code no
Moisture Sensitivity Level (MSL) 1
Number of Terminations 20
ECCN Code EAR99
Max Operating Temperature 85°C
Min Operating Temperature -40°C
Additional Feature ECL MODE: VCC = 0V WITH VEE = -2.375V TO -3.8V
Subcategory Clock Drivers
Technology ECL
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 225
Number of Functions 1
Supply Voltage 2.5V
Terminal Pitch 0.65mm
Time@Peak Reflow Temperature-Max (s) 30
Pin Count 20
Supply Voltage-Max (Vsup) 3.8V
Power Supplies +-2.5/+-3.3V
Temperature Grade INDUSTRIAL
